I have one theme generating an error when trying to install 2.0.14. Unfortunately the theme author is Crip who is no longer with us so I can't go to him for help. Could someone help me figure this out?

The problem is I can't find this code in the theme's index.template.php file

<input type="hidden" name="hash_passwrd" value="" />

to replace it with the code below because it doesn't exist.

<input type="hidden" name="hash_passwrd" value="" /><input type="hidden" name="', $context['session_var'], '" value="', $context['session_id'], '" />

Where do I go from here? I have one user that uses this theme so I'd rather not just uninstall it, I'd prefer to get it working if I can to try out the new image proxy feature in 2.0.14.
